This is a tough one to write. Snooky Prior was one of my inspirations, and
though I only knew him through his recordings, I always felt like there was
a connection between us. His strong, unabashed wailing harmonica and honest
down-to-earth singing style captured me young, and some of his songs became
my own standards. It was his spirit that attracted me to his music, and its
his spirit that the world still has today. Snooky is gone from this mortal
realm. He was the witness to many trials and tribulations, and stood tall
throughout. I know that when he approached the seat of judgement, he was
ushered into paradise in a golden beam. People say he was the first harp
player to play through an amplifier - I believe it. He would have been
trying to sound like the trumpets at Jericho. It was partially due to that
call of his that I came to the blues. I am humbled in the shadow of his
musical accomplishments, and in the straight and narrow grace with which he
lived his life. -----Bear Claw Bob
